Astronomy: Exploring the Wonders of the Universe

In the vast expanse of our universe lies a realm that has captivated humans for centuries – astronomy. From ancient civilizations observing celestial bodies to modern-day space exploration, this field offers a glimpse into the wonders of our cosmic neighborhood and beyond. In this article, we will delve into the fascinating world of astronomy and explore how it can engage alternative schooling students in a unique educational experience.

At its core, astronomy is the scientific study of celestial objects such as stars, planets, galaxies, and their interactions. It encompasses various branches like observational astronomy (studying through telescopes), theoretical astrophysics (using mathematical models), and planetary science (exploring planets). By introducing students to these diverse realms, alternative education platforms can foster curiosity and critical thinking skills.

One way to engage students in astronomical pursuits is through stargazing sessions. With minimal equipment like binoculars or telescopes, learners can observe star clusters, nebulae, or even planets from their own backyards. Encouraging them to identify constellations or track visible phenomena like meteor showers instills a sense of wonder while promoting observational skills.

Moreover, alternative schools can leverage online resources that provide interactive simulations and virtual tours of celestial bodies. Students can explore detailed images captured by satellites or rovers on other planets; they may also witness cosmic events like supernovae or black hole mergers through visualizations based on real data.

In addition to practical activities, understanding astronomical concepts aids interdisciplinary learning across subjects such as physics, mathematics, chemistry,and even history. For instance,’ Kepler’s Laws’ explain planetary motion using mathematical principles derived from observations made by Johannes Kepler in the 17th century – making connections between historical context and scientific theory.

Furthermore,astronomy offers an excellent opportunity for project-based learning where students conduct research on specific topics related to space exploration.For example,a group project could involve designing a mission to Mars, requiring students to consider factors such as launch windows, fuel consumption, and environmental impact.

To enhance student engagement and collaboration, alternative schools can organize field trips to planetariums or observatories. These visits expose learners to advanced telescopes and experts in the field who explain complex phenomena in an accessible manner. The immersive experience of observing celestial objects through powerful telescopes leaves a lasting impression on young minds.
